radrigo 179 Опубликовано: 2 октября 2020 Рассказать Опубликовано: 2 октября 2020 В некоторых случаях в кратких новостях не выводятся иконка для категорий при помощи {category-icon}. Попробую смоделировать ситуацию при которой возникает проблема. Существует главная категория category и в ней подкатегория. В главной категории задан шаблон коротких новостей, чтобы имя файла шаблона не было shortstory. Иконка задана только в подкатегории. В таком случае при открытии главной категории (sait.ru/category/) в кратких новостях не выводятся иконка при помощи {category-icon}. Стоит сделать в главной категории шаблон краткой новости по умолчанию, иконка сразу будет выводиться. Надеюсь объяснил понятно. Проверял также на чистой версии движка. В прошлой версии движка таких проблем не было.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 072 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 15 часов назад, radrigo сказал: Существует главная категория category и в ней подкатегория. 15 часов назад, radrigo сказал: В таком случае при открытии главной категории (sait.ru/category/) в кратких новостях не выводятся иконка 15 часов назад, radrigo сказал: Иконка задана только в подкатегории. Непонятна суть вашей логики. Все категории обладают своими настройками. Они не наследуют настройки друг друга, даже если подкатегории. Если вы не задали иконку главной категории, а задали ее только подкатегории, то какую иконку вы должны увидеть при просмотре главной категории? Она же не задана для главной категории. Цитата Ссылка на сообщение Поделиться на других сайтах
radrigo 179 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 (изменено) Автор 1 час назад, celsoft сказал: Непонятна суть вашей логики. Все категории обладают своими настройками. Они не наследуют настройки друг друга, даже если подкатегории. Если вы не задали иконку главной категории, а задали ее только подкатегории, то какую иконку вы должны увидеть при просмотре главной категории? Она же не задана для главной категории. Раньше ведь так работало и всё было логично. Да и сейчас без шаблона краткой новости в главной категории показывает иконку из подкатегории. В данном случае мне кажется логичнее, когда при просмотре главной категории чтобы показывались иконки тех категорий, к которым принадлежит новость. А новости принадлежат именно подкатегориям. Простой пример у меня на сайте. Раздел объявлений. https://gusev-online.ru/obyavleniya/ Как вы можете наблюдать, в кратких новостях показывается название подкатегории. Рядом должна ещё показываться иконка подкатегории, но она не показывается. Если же просматриваем подкатегорию, то иконки показываться. https://gusev-online.ru/obyavleniya/transport/ Следуя вашей логике, при просмотре главной категории {category} должен показывать не названия подкатегории, а название главной категории. Изменено 3 октября 2020 пользователем radrigo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 072 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 47 минут назад, radrigo сказал: Раньше ведь так работало и всё было логично. Да и сейчас без шаблона краткой новости в главной категории показывает иконку из подкатегории. В данном случае мне кажется логичнее, когда при просмотре главной категории чтобы показывались иконки тех категорий, к которым принадлежит новость. А новости принадлежат именно подкатегориям. Так подождите, речь идет о показе иконки непосредственно в новости, а не как глобальный тег, верно? Новость принадлежит только одной категории? Т.е. при назначении категории для новости вы назначаете только одну категорию ей, а именно подкатегорию, а не две категории сразу, категорию и подкатегорию. Верно? Если два утверждения верны, то должна показываться иконка подкатегории у новости. Если это не так, то это уже баг. Я проверю этот момент. Цитата Ссылка на сообщение Поделиться на других сайтах
radrigo 179 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 Автор 4 минуты назад, celsoft сказал: Так подождите, речь идет о показе иконки непосредственно в новости, а не как глобальный тег, верно? Новость принадлежит только одной категории? Т.е. при назначении категории для новости вы назначаете только одну категорию ей, а именно подкатегорию, а не две категории сразу, категорию и подкатегорию. Верно? Если два утверждения верны, то должна показываться иконка подкатегории у новости. Если это не так, то это уже баг. Я проверю этот момент. Да, именно так. Новость принадлежит только одной категории, а именно подкатегории.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 072 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 Да, теперь все понятно. Принято. Баг подтвержден и будет исправлен в следующей версии скрипта. Цитата Ссылка на сообщение Поделиться на других сайтах
radrigo 179 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 Автор 2 минуты назад, celsoft сказал: Да, теперь все понятно. Принято. Баг подтвержден и будет исправлен в следующей версии скрипта. А можно как-то исправить сейчас? Может можно незначительные изменения где-то в файлах сделать? До следующей версии ещё далеко. Цитата Ссылка на сообщение Поделиться на других сайтах
celsoft 6 072 Опубликовано: 3 октября 2020 Рассказать Опубликовано: 3 октября 2020 каких либо готовых решений у меня на данный момент нет. Это просто ушло в список обязательных исправлений для новых версий, какое либо исправление еще не делалось. Цитата Ссылка на сообщение Поделиться на других сайтах
Рекомендованные сообщения
Присоединяйтесь к обсуждению
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.